Hit the trinity today for the first time in over a year. Finally caught a steelhead. It was a 20" bright chrome fish. Lost one other about that size. My buddy that I was with caught two in the 20" range and lost one that was much bigger. He also caught a 16" brown. Water was low and clear. River got pretty busy by late morning. Saw quite a few salmon still moving through.

On rivers that you can drive along, like the Klamath or Trinity, just keep driving upstream or down stream till you see parked cars, drift boats or rolling steelhead.

You can quickly sample all the good looking water, but keep moving till you find fish.
